3. Christ Our Leader

1 For Christ our Prince and Saviour,
For truth and holiness,
We wage a constant warfare,
And onward boldly press;
We brave the sternest conflict,
By conscious strength inspired,
Our hearts by fear unshaken,
Our souls by courage fired.

2 The war we wage is bloodless,
We fight not to destroy,
The motto on our banner,
Is “Pardon, Peace, and Joy;”
We strive to free the captive,
Now held by sin a slave,
To cheer the faint and hopeless,
And make the trembling brave.

3 But Christ hath all the honor,
‘Tis He that makes us strong,
The trophies of each conquest,
To Him alone belong;
And his shall be the triumph,
The glory and renown,
And His the praise exulting,
And His the victor’s crown.

Text Information
First Line: For Christ our Prince and Saviour
Title: Christ Our Leader
Author: Rev. Robert F. Gordon
Language: English
Publication Date: 1894
Topic: Warfare
